Overview

Wenzhong Shen is affiliated with Shanghai Jiao Tong University in China. Their research focuses primarily on engineering and materials science, with particular attention to subfields such as electrical and electronic engineering, materials chemistry, atomic and molecular physics and optics, polymers and plastics, and biomedical engineering.

Their work spans several main topics, including:

  • Silicon and Solar Cell Technologies
  • Perovskite Materials and Applications
  • Thin-Film Transistor Technologies
  • Quantum Dots Synthesis And Properties
  • Chalcogenide Semiconductor Thin Films
  • Semiconductor materials and interfaces
  • Conducting polymers and applications
